Irish business leader made non-executive director at Norland

Brian Montague has been appointed a non-executive director by Norland Managed Services.
He will assist Tommy Fitzpatrick, Norland's business unit director in Ireland, in developing its business in the country, together with overseas markets.

Norland established its Irish business in Dublin in 2008.

Mr Montague owns a number of concerns. He was chief executive of A&L Goodbody Solicitors until 2009 and group human resources director at Eircom. Previously, he held several positions at British Airways, including HR director for the National Air Traffic Services (NATS).
